Built in 1665, this palace has a façade that is decorated with balustrade balconies on consoles of sculpted marble and pilasters. After seeing the pharmacy, there is a majestic ceremonial staircase, followed by a prestigious baluster staircase leading upstairs with a number of rocaille vaults and niches. Upstairs, the ceiling is covered in trompe-l'oeil frescos, and there are Flemish tapestries, atlases and caryatids, and Louis XV woodwork encrusted with gold leaf.

The Museum of Modern and Contemporary Art contains works from the Nice school, its earlier influences and later effects. The new realists include Arman, César and Spoerri. Pride of place goes to Yves Klein (1928-1962) with his blue monochromes. The neo-Dadaist Fkuxus movement is represented by Ben. Development in abstraction is illustrated by Supports/Surfaces (Vaillat, Pagès, Dezeuze). The return to figuration by Garouste and, in a style inspired by cartoon strips, Combas and Hervé di Rosa.
Asian Arts Museum
Designed by the Japanese architect Kenzo Tange, in the heart of Parc Phœnix, in a subtle architecture of white marble, glass and steel, this museum offers classical works and contemporary creations. The tea pavilion evokes the aestheticism of the Zen ceremony.

Built on a prehistoric site with the oldest houses built by man (400,000 years old), this museum contains stone tools, bones, building foundations and laboratory analyses concerning the environment and climate, leading you from the digs to reconstructions.

This museum contains the largest permanent collection of work by Marc Chagall (1887-1985). 17 large paintings make up the artist's Message Biblique. These compositions describe the Creation, earthly paradise, the Flood, the Song of Songs, etc. The museum also contains a tapestry (La Création), an external mosaic and three large stained-glass windows.

Dominating the sea, this 17C villa, with its Sienna earth colour, houses around 30 paintings by Matisse (1869-1954). From dark palettes to canvases lit with the Mediterranean sun, then, after a stay in Morocco, to pure colour, and finally to the refined drawing of cut papers in absolute blue poster paint. 54 bronzes, sketches and models complete the panorama.

The Archaeological Museum contains bronzes and ceramics illustrating the great Mediterranean civilisations. The Mask of Silène is marvellous. The Ligurian and Roman influences are shown by the archaic statuette of the soldier of Mount Bégo, tools of the Oppidas, the military borders of Via Julia Augusta and a collection of coins. The museum also contains steles and sarcophaguses and an early Christian collection.
Theatre de la Photographie et de l'Image
The "Théâtre de la Photographie et de l'Image" in the heart of Nice in the building which formerly housed the "Théâtre de l'Artistique", has maintained its charm and elegance of the Belle Epoque period. Its mission is to collect photographs of Nice and its region by researching ancient documents but also sending photographers to "report" on the city's human, urban, historic and industrial heritage.
